The Spain Armor Materials Market is witnessing steady growth driven by increasing defense expenditures, advancements in military technologies, and rising security concerns. The market comprises various materials such as ceramics, metals, composites, and aramid fibers used in the manufacturing of body armor, vehicle armor, and aircraft armor among others. Key market players are focusing on developing lightweight and high-performance armor materials to enhance protection levels while ensuring mobility and comfort for the end-users. The demand for armor materials in Spain is primarily being fueled by the defense sector, law enforcement agencies, and the automotive industry. With ongoing research and development activities aimed at improving the ballistic resistance and durability of armor materials, the market is poised for further expansion in the coming years.

In Spain, government policies related to the Armor Materials Market primarily revolve around defense procurement and industrial development. The Spanish government has been investing in the development and acquisition of advanced armor materials to enhance the capabilities of its armed forces and ensure national security. These policies aim to support domestic production of armor materials, promote technological innovation, and strengthen the country`s defense industry. Additionally, Spain is part of the European Union`s common security and defense policy, which involves collaboration with other member states in research, development, and procurement of armor materials for military applications. Overall, the government`s policies in this sector focus on ensuring a strong and resilient national defense capability through strategic investments and partnerships within the European defense framework.
